Intro
G Dsus2 Em9
E ----------3------------------0-----------------------0------
B ------------3----------3--------3-----------------3-----3---
G ----0---------0-----------2--------2----------------------0-
D -------0---------0--0-----------------0--------2------------
A --------------------------------------------2---------------
E -3---------------------------------------0------------------
C6/9
E -------------0------
B ----------3-----3---
G -------0----------0-
D ----2---------------
A -3------------------
E --------------------
Repeat that 4x and then the electric guitar comes in with the same notes but in power chords
(hit the chords once).
All this while guitar #1 is still playing the intro riff.
After a while the chords change:
(Electric guitar only)
A5 C5 G5 G5
A5 C5 G5 B5 C5

How do you do that chord?
G Dsus2 Em9 C6/9
E ----3-----0------0------0--
B ----3-----3------3------3--
G ----0-----2------0------0--
D ----0------------2------2--
A ----2------------2------3--
E ----3------------0------0--
